A step by step how to remove, reseal, and reinstall the differential in most E36 BMW 3 series. I also replace the front differential bushing which is a common failure part.
This is my Aegean Blue 97 328i convertible, which I swapped in an S52, M3 front and rear subframes and a lot of other parts in the process of that build. I used an automatic M3 3.38 rear differential and after 5-6k miles, wanted to swap to a 3.15 differential from a 93 325i. I also wanted to replace that bushing that I overlooked when I put this car together. I replaced the rear cover gasket, both axle seals and the pinion seal prior to installing the new differential.
Unfortunately I let this car sit for a couple of years in my lower garage and the clutch hydraulic system wasn't too happy when I tried to drive it again. Thankfully, the only part that failed in that system was the cheap rubber hose in the center of the hydraulic system.
